What Are the Key Features to Look for in a Bunk Bed Mattress?

The key features to look for in a bunk bed mattress include:

  • Thickness: The thickness of the mattress is crucial for safety and comfort. A mattress that is too thick may pose a risk of falling over the guardrails, while a very thin mattress may not provide adequate support.
  • Material: The material of the mattress affects durability and comfort. Options include memory foam, latex, and innerspring, each offering different levels of support and pressure relief.
  • Weight Limit: It’s important to check the weight limit of the mattress to ensure it can safely support the intended user. Exceeding this limit can lead to potential safety hazards and premature wear of the mattress.
  • Fire Safety: Look for mattresses that meet safety standards for flammability. Many bunk bed mattresses are treated with fire retardants to ensure they comply with regulations and provide an added layer of safety.
  • Certifications: Check for certifications like CertiPUR-US or GREENGUARD, which indicate that the mattress meets specific environmental and health standards. These certifications can give peace of mind regarding the materials used in the mattress.
  • Edge Support: Good edge support is essential for bunk bed mattresses, as it helps maintain the mattress shape and provides a stable surface for sitting and getting in and out of bed. This feature is especially important for children who may move around frequently during sleep.
  • Comfort Level: Different mattresses offer varying levels of firmness, which can impact sleep quality. It’s important to choose a comfort level that suits the sleeper’s preferences, whether they prefer a firmer or softer surface.
  • Ease of Cleaning: Consider a mattress with removable and washable covers or one that is easy to wipe down. This feature is particularly useful for children’s beds, as spills and accidents are more likely to occur.

How Does Mattress Size Affect Fit and Safety in Bunk Beds?

The size of a mattress significantly impacts both the fit and safety of bunk beds, influencing comfort and risk factors.

  • Standard Twin Size: The standard twin mattress, measuring 38 inches by 75 inches, is the most common choice for bunk beds, ensuring a snug fit that minimizes gaps. This size allows for safe use, as it prevents the risk of falls due to improper alignment or excessive space between the mattress and guardrails.
  • Twin XL Size: A twin XL mattress is 38 inches by 80 inches, providing additional length for taller individuals. While it still fits most standard bunk beds, it is essential to check compatibility, as using a longer mattress may create gaps or lead to unsafe conditions if not properly secured.
  • Full Size: The full-size mattress measures 54 inches by 75 inches, offering more sleeping space but may not fit in standard bunk beds without modifications or custom builds. If a full-size mattress is used, it is crucial to ensure the bunk bed has the appropriate design and safety features, such as higher guardrails, to accommodate the increased size and prevent accidents.
  • Thickness Considerations: The thickness of the mattress also plays a role in fit and safety; mattresses that are too thick can exceed the height of the guardrails, increasing the risk of falls. A thickness of 6 to 8 inches is often recommended for bunk beds to ensure that the mattress does not extend beyond the protective barriers.
  • Material and Firmness: The material and firmness of the mattress can affect comfort levels and sleep quality, which are essential for children using bunk beds. It’s advisable to select a mattress that is firm enough to support a child’s growing body while still being comfortable enough for restful sleep, thereby promoting a safe sleeping environment.

What Are the Advantages of Memory Foam vs. Innerspring Mattresses for Bunk Beds?

Feature Memory Foam Innerspring
Comfort Conforms to body shape, providing personalized comfort and pressure relief. Offers a traditional feel with a bouncier surface, which may be preferred by some users.
Support Even weight distribution helps with spinal alignment and reduces motion transfer. Provides good support, but may not contour as well, leading to pressure points.
Durability Generally longer-lasting due to high-density materials that resist sagging. Can wear out faster; coils may become less supportive over time.
Price Typically more expensive due to advanced materials and technology. Generally more affordable, making them accessible for budget-conscious buyers.
Weight Consideration Lightweight; easier to handle and move, which is beneficial for bunk beds. Can be heavier due to metal springs, making them more challenging to adjust.
Temperature Regulation May retain heat, but many modern memory foam options include cooling technologies. Typically better airflow due to coil structure, which can help keep sleepers cooler.
Allergy Resistance Often resistant to dust mites and mold, making them a good choice for allergy sufferers. Can harbor dust mites and allergens due to the fabric and materials used.
Ease of Movement Can be more difficult to move on due to the sinkage effect of foam. Generally easier to move on due to the bounciness of the coils.
